How Vending Machines Work: The Mechanics of Price Hacking
So, how exactly do vending machines work, and how can hackers manipulate the prices?
Vending machines use a complex system of electronic controls, coin acceptors, and dispensing mechanisms to deliver products to customers. The prices displayed on the machine are typically set by the manufacturer or the vending machine owner, and are stored in the machine’s memory.
However, hackers can exploit vulnerabilities in the machine’s software and hardware to alter the prices displayed on the screen. This can be done using a variety of methods, including physical tampering, software hacks, or even social engineering techniques.
